The Pre-Teen Ohio
Scholarship and Recognition Program was held recently at the
Columbus-Worthington Holiday Inn in Columbus. Approximately 115 of Ohio’s
best and brightest top female honor roll students, ages 7 – 12 years old,
competed for over $5,000 in educational bonds, prizes, and awards, as well
as, for the opportunity to qualify for competition in the 2002 Pre-Teen
America National Competition to be held July 3 -
8, 2002 at the Sheraton
Hotel in Birmingham, Alabama, where they will have the opportunity to
compete for over $25,000 in educational bonds, prizes, and awards.The participants were evaluated in seven judging criteria divisions including (1) Academic Achievement (2) Volunteer Service to Church and Community (3) School Honors and Activities (4) Development of Personal Skills and Abilities (5) general Knowledgeability (6) Communicative Ability (7) On-Stage Expressiveness and Overall Pre-Teen Image.
